Clay
Clay's waterfall enrichment engine represents a paradigm shift in how sales teams access prospect data. Rather than querying a single database and accepting whatever information is available, Clay sequentially queries multiple premium data providers in a customizable order, automatically moving to the next source when the previous one lacks the required information. This intelligent cascading approach maximizes data coverage while optimizing costs by prioritizing less expensive sources first. Users can configure enrichment waterfalls for emails, phone numbers, company data, technographics, and custom attributes, with the system automatically deduplicating and validating results. The platform supports over 50 data sources including LinkedIn Sales Navigator, Apollo, Hunter.io, Clearbit, ZoomInfo, Lusha, RocketReach, and specialized industry databases, enabling enrichment rates of 70-90% compared to the 40-50% typical of single-source solutions. Achieve dramatically higher data coverage and accuracy while reducing per-record costs through intelligent source prioritization and automatic fallback logic.

Clay
Clay's spreadsheet-inspired interface democratizes complex data operations, allowing non-technical users to build sophisticated prospecting workflows through an intuitive visual builder. Each column in Clay represents a data operation—whether pulling information from an API, running an AI enrichment, applying a formula, or triggering an action—creating a transparent, auditable workflow that's easy to understand and modify. Users can chain multiple operations together, with each step's output feeding into subsequent steps, enabling complex multi-stage enrichment and qualification processes. The platform supports conditional logic, allowing different enrichment paths based on prospect attributes, and includes pre-built templates for common use cases like finding decision-makers at target accounts or identifying companies using specific technologies. Version history and collaboration features enable teams to iterate on workflows together while maintaining accountability. Empower sales operations teams to build and iterate on complex prospecting workflows without engineering resources, reducing time-to-value from weeks to hours.

Clay
Clay seamlessly connects with the broader sales technology stack through native integrations with major CRMs and sales engagement platforms, ensuring enriched data flows directly into existing workflows without manual export/import cycles. Bidirectional Salesforce and HubSpot integrations enable users to pull existing leads and accounts into Clay for enrichment, then push updated records back with new data fields automatically mapped to CRM properties. Integration with outreach platforms like Outreach.io, Salesloft, Apollo, and Instantly allows users to push enriched prospects directly into sequences with personalized messaging already populated. Webhook support and a robust API enable custom integrations with any system, while Zapier connectivity provides no-code integration options for teams without development resources. The platform maintains sync logs and error handling to ensure data integrity across systems. Eliminate manual data entry and ensure enriched prospect data automatically flows into CRM and outreach tools, maintaining data consistency while accelerating speed-to-outreach.

Waterfall Data Enrichment with 75+ Integrated Data Providers
Source: Clay's most distinctive capability is its waterfall enrichment system that automatically queries 75+ premium data providers in sequence to maximize data coverage. Unlike competitors that rely on a single data source, Clay's approach ensures that if one provider doesn't have a prospect's email or phone number, the system automatically tries the next provider until it finds valid data. According to Clay's documentation, this approach achieves up to 3x higher enrichment rates compared to single-source solutions. The platform aggregates data from providers including Clearbit, ZoomInfo, Apollo, Hunter, Lusha, and dozens more—all accessible through a single credit system rather than requiring separate subscriptions to each service.
